Research on the Automatic Recognition Method of Micro-nano Regeneration Rubber Filler Dispersion in Scanning Electron Microscope Images
Micro-nano regenerative rubber represents a significant advancement over traditional regenerative rubber by eliminating the need for polluting chemical agents such as coal tar, asphalt, and regenerators.
